The Importance of Eco-friendly Furniture

Eco-friendly furniture, as the name suggests, is designed to minimize harm to the environment. It’s often made from renewable or recycled materials, produced using sustainable methods, and designed for long-term use. Switching to eco-friendly furniture is a significant step towards a sustainable future, as it reduces deforestation, curbs excessive waste, and lowers carbon footprint.

But the benefits of eco-friendly furniture aren’t limited to the environment. The design and materials used often contribute to better indoor air quality, reduced exposure to harmful chemicals, and improved health for your employees.

How Eco-friendly Furniture Helps the Environment

The production of traditional office furniture often involves the extensive use of non-renewable resources, contributing to deforestation, waste, and carbon emissions. Conversely, eco-friendly furniture takes a greener approach. Let’s break down how:

    Resource Management: Eco-friendly furniture is typically made from renewable or recycled materials like reclaimed wood, bamboo, or recycled metal and plastic. This responsible use of resources reduces the demand for virgin materials, thereby mitigating deforestation and excessive resource extraction.

    Low Impact Manufacturing: Manufacturers of eco-friendly furniture use production processes that minimize environmental harm. This includes the use of energy-efficient machinery, clean energy, and water-saving methods.

    Durability: Sustainable furniture is designed for longevity, reducing the frequency of replacement and the resultant waste.

How Eco-friendly Furniture Promotes Health and Well-being

One lesser-known benefit of eco-friendly furniture is its contribution to indoor health. Traditional office furniture is often laden with synthetic materials and chemicals that release volatile organic compounds (VOCs) into the air, potentially leading to health issues among employees. Eco-friendly furniture, however, minimizes the use of such harmful substances.

For instance, it often uses natural or low-VOC finishes, contributing to better air quality. Furthermore, the ergonomic design of many eco-friendly furniture pieces enhances comfort and reduces strain, thus promoting employees’ physical well-being.

Steps to Transform Your Office with Eco-friendly Office Furniture

Transforming your office into an eco-friendly space involves more than just replacing old desks and chairs. Here are some key steps:

  1. Evaluate Your Needs: Consider factors like the number of employees, office layout, and work style. This will guide you in selecting the right type and quantity of furniture.
  2. Choose the Right Materials: Opt for furniture made from sustainable or recycled materials. Look for certifications like GreenGuard or FSC to ensure you’re making environmentally friendly choices.
  3. Consider End-of-Life: Choose furniture that’s durable, reusable, or recyclable to reduce waste at the end of its life cycle.
  4. Work with Eco-friendly Suppliers: Partner with suppliers who are committed to sustainability. They should have transparent and verifiable practices concerning their materials sourcing, production methods, and distribution.

Tips for Maintaining Your Furniture

Proper maintenance can extend the lifespan of your furniture. Here are a few tips:

  1. Follow the manufacturer’s cleaning instructions to avoid damaging the material or finish.
  2. Regularly check for wear and tear to address any issues promptly.
  3. If the furniture gets damaged, explore repair options before considering replacement.
